Career path

Career Role (Art Market Data Management) Description
Art Market Analyst (Data-Driven) Analyze market trends, using data to inform investment strategies and pricing. Crucial for galleries and auction houses.
Data Scientist (Fine Art) Develop predictive models leveraging art market data to identify investment opportunities and risks. High demand in the sector.
Database Administrator (Art & Antiques) Manage and maintain large databases of art market information, ensuring data integrity and accessibility for analysts.
Art Market Research Specialist (Quantitative) Conduct primary and secondary research using quantitative methods to inform market analysis reports.
Digital Asset Manager (Art) Responsible for managing digital assets, metadata, and data related to art collections. Growing area with great potential.
